How do the different connective tissues of the muscles relate to one another?

The connective tissue fibers of the endomysium and perimysium are interwoven, and those of the perimysium blend into those of the epimysium. At the ends of the muscle the fibers of the epimysium converge to form a fibrous extension known as a tendon. All of the connective tissues in the muscle contain the same fiber components.
